From mboxrd@z Thu Jan 1 00:00:00 1970 Path: main.gmane.org!not-for-mail From: Marc Singer Newsgroups: gmane.lisp.guile.user Subject: Re: Passing lambda bindings to C for use as callback Date: Tue, 26 Nov 2002 12:55:56 -0800 Sender: guile-user-admin@gnu.org Message-ID: <20021126205556.GA26545@buici.com> References: <20021126024544.GA24594@buici.com> <20021126032223.GB24594@buici.com> <873cpojzuf.fsf@zagadka.ping.de> NNTP-Posting-Host: main.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ii X-Trace: main.gmane.org 1038345824 6405 80.91.224.249 (26 Nov 2002 21:23:44 GMT) X-Complaints-To: usenet@main.gmane.org NNTP-Posting-Date: Tue, 26 Nov 2002 21:23:44 +0000 (UTC) Cc: guile-user@gnu.org Return-path: Original-Received: from monty-python.gnu.org ([199.232.76.173]) by main.gmane.org with esmtp (Exim 3.35 #1 (Debian)) id 18Gmyd-0000rN-00 for ; Tue, 26 Nov 2002 22:10:39 +0100 Original-Received: from localhost ([127.0.0.1] helo=monty-python.gnu.org) by monty-python.gnu.org with esmtp (Exim 4.10) id 18GmkW-0001MP-00; Tue, 26 Nov 2002 15:56:04 -0500 Original-Received: from list by monty-python.gnu.org with tmda-scanned (Exim 4.10) id 18GmkR-0001M5-00 for guile-user@gnu.org; Tue, 26 Nov 2002 15:55:59 -0500 Original-Received: from mail by monty-python.gnu.org with spam-scanned (Exim 4.10) id 18GmkP-0001Lq-00 for guile-user@gnu.org; Tue, 26 Nov 2002 15:55:58 -0500 Original-Received: from florence.buici.com ([206.124.142.26]) by monty-python.gnu.org with smtp (Exim 4.10) id 18GmkP-0001Ll-00 for guile-user@gnu.org; Tue, 26 Nov 2002 15:55:57 -0500 Original-Received: (qmail 26678 invoked by uid 1000); 26 Nov 2002 20:55:56 -0000 Original-To: Marius Vollmer Content-Disposition: inline In-Reply-To: <873cpojzuf.fsf@zagadka.ping.de> User-Agent: Mutt/1.4i Errors-To: guile-user-admin@gnu.org X-BeenThere: guile-user@gnu.org X-Mailman-Version: 2.0.11 Precedence: bulk List-Help: List-Post: List-Subscribe: , List-Id: General Guile related discussions List-Unsubscribe: , List-Archive: Xref: main.gmane.org gmane.lisp.guile.user:1383 X-Report-Spam: http://spam.gmane.org/gmane.lisp.guile.user:1383 On Tue, Nov 26, 2002 at 01:10:48PM +0100, Marius Vollmer wrote: > You can also pass the SCM objects that you want to protect globally to > the function scm_gc_protect_object. Guile will then keep the data > structure for you. You can unprotect such an object with > scm_gc_unprotect_object. For objects that you wont ever unprotect you > can also use scm_permanent_object. Was this added after v1.4? _______________________________________________ Guile-user mailing list Guile-user@gnu.org http://mail.gnu.org/mailman/listinfo/guile-user